At Village Tavern, we're all about gathering 'round with friends and family over a great burger and some friendly competition. Our sports bar atmosphere is warm and inviting, with a cozy fireplace and stunning stained-glass windows that add to the ambiance. We've got TVs and pool tables to keep you entertained, whether you're catching a game or just hanging out with loved ones. Our menu features mouth-watering burgers made with fresh, high-quality ingredients - ask about our signature 'Village Burger' for a taste of local excellence.

Village Tavern is a popular bar known for its great atmosphere, friendly bartenders like John, Leah and Mary, and a wide selection of drinks. It's a good spot to watch sports and enjoy music. Some customers have complained about rude bartenders and high prices.
